Transaction 95988dc715dd5a5a1904230f71159d2fece84d26bc44395e80ecbef5d00a8f56
1 Input
2 Outputs
- 95988dc715dd5a5a1904230f71159d2fece84d26bc44395e80ecbef5d00a8f56:0
- 95988dc715dd5a5a1904230f71159d2fece84d26bc44395e80ecbef5d00a8f56:1
value 111293
address 143rrMde7jJweBfjuDSv6AyjGawHBy66XQ
value 16554281
address 15RpmjeiRJyLyLRq42vAt1rwoJEZkxgW5a